Output 35b762665a751052ca2c8dbc95ffe0f8c0b11c63464101ff869a017b024c60af:0

value
141126652
script pubkey
OP_0 OP_PUSHBYTES_20 e8d296b7f53744575fd87e055ae74a60b57cff8d
address
bc1qarffddl4xaz9wh7c0cz44e62vz6heludvkddx7
transaction
35b762665a751052ca2c8dbc95ffe0f8c0b11c63464101ff869a017b024c60af
spent
true